Biography
Personal Profile
Dean of the Brain Hospital and Director of the Department of Neurosurgery, Zhongnan Hospital of Wuhan University; Chief Physician, Professor, and Doctoral Supervisor.
With over 30 years of clinical experience in neurosurgery, he is particularly proficient in the microsurgical treatment of cerebrovascular diseases (such as aneurysms, arteriovenous malformations, and moyamoya disease) and the comprehensive treatment of skull base tumors including acoustic neuromas and pineal region tumors. He ranked among the top 10 in cerebrovascular surgery in the National Top 100 Famous Doctors List.
Leading his team, he has achieved outstanding results in the clinical practice and scientific research of moyamoya disease. He innovated the "Dujiangyan-style" bypass surgery, which has gained international recognition and been published in top international professional journals.

Research
His research focuses on cerebrovascular diseases and Alzheimer's disease. In the past 5 years, he innovated the "Dujiangyan-style" bypass surgery for moyamoya disease, reducing the postoperative symptomatic hyperperfusion rate to below 5% and benefiting over 700 patients. The relevant technology has won 2 Second Prizes of the Hubei Provincial Science and Technology Progress Award. In the future, he plans to develop cerebrospinal fluid replacement equipment to advance the treatment of Alzheimer's disease and explore the inflammatory mechanism of moyamoya disease using single-cell sequencing.
In terms of academic papers, he has published research results in top-tier journals such as Journal of Neurosurgery and Chest. In the past 5 years, his core papers have focused on directions including blood flow regulation in moyamoya disease. The department he leads has published more than 200 academic papers in the past 3 years.
Regarding research projects, he has presided over 3 National Natural Science Foundation of China (NSFC) projects (e.g., "TUG1-Mediated Vascular Inflammation and the Mechanism of Moyamoya Disease") and 1 Major Technological Innovation Project of Hubei Province, with a total funding of over 3.8 million yuan.
In addition, he led the compilation of Expert Consensus on Surgical Treatment of Moyamoya Disease in China (2024 Edition) and served as the chief translator of Surgical Techniques for Moyamoya Angiopathy. He has obtained 3 Chinese invention patents, including one for the "Novel Adjustable Pressure Suction Tip".
